Transaction 61e8438845db460638388f0de3266db9431af8c12fb34577913f01de649fbd4a
1 Input
2 Outputs
- 61e8438845db460638388f0de3266db9431af8c12fb34577913f01de649fbd4a:0
- 61e8438845db460638388f0de3266db9431af8c12fb34577913f01de649fbd4a:1
value 377300
address 3Q8WuDp6TZbbs5poLaGVQmJTGAP74w1WGx
value 6532942
address 1CrffF56D3zdCsDj9SBKJGwLRjoCtc5ngn